DES MOINES, Iowa — The Polk County Sheriff’s Office has made an arrest in the Lumberyard shooting that left one dead on Saturday.
Polk County deputies were called to the Lumberyard, located at 1504 NE 54th Avenue, on reports of shots fired around 3:41 a.m. Saturday morning. Crews arrived and located a deceased adult male in the parking lot.
Authorities opened and investigation and began interviewing witnesses. Just before 2 p.m. on Saturday, the Polk County SO announced that 30-year-old Derico Darrell Lowery had been arrested. Lowery was taken to the Polk County Jail and has been charged with Murder in the First Degree and Felon in Possession of a Firearm.
On Sunday, the Polk County SO shared that the victim of the shooting was 28-year-old De’Tavion Marques Levi of Des Moines, Iowa.
